FINDINGS

Upon the whole record and all the evidence. the Board finds that the parties herein are carrier and employee within the meaning of the Railway Labor ALL as amended.- Further. the Board is duly constituted by Agreement. bas jurisdiction of the Parties and of the subject matter. and the Parties to this dispute were given due notice of the hearing thereon.

Claimant. with a seniority date of July 18. 1994. was absent without authority on five consecutive workdays. November 27 through December 1. 1995.

An Investigation was finally set for 1 PNI. Jauuarl· 10. 1996. Clainumt was not present at 1 PNL so die pities preceded in leis absence. The Investigation was concluded at 1315 hours. At 1330 hours. Claimant arrived on the scene, whereby Carrier reconvened the Investigation. The Carrier played the tape of the Investigation just concluded for the benefit of Claimant. who admitted that the testimony of the Carrier witness was correct. and that lie was off without authorization November 27 through December 1. 1995. lie did not deny that his absences were alcohol related.


      When an employee is absent without authorization for five consecutive workdays. the

employee's seniority is teinunated. but lie has tile right to request ail Investigation. The intent of the Investigation is to allow the employee the opportunity to offer reasons that would mitigate the termination. Claimant had nothing to offer and. in fact. admitted he was off five successive workdats without authorization.

The .Agreement Rule clearly spells out the consequences of being absent five consecutive workdays without authority. This Board cannot. in tiny way. modify the tennis of tile Agreement Rule.


                          AWARD


      Claim denied.
